New Delhi: Bollywood bundle of energy star Ranveer Singh must be feeling on top of the world. And, well, rightly so! His recently released 'Gully Boy' has hit the jackpot at the ticket counters and already broken many records on day 1 collections.

The film has left behind Ranveer's period drama 'Padmaavat' in opening day collection and emerged on second spot just behind 'Simmba'. Noted film critic and trade analyst Taran Adarsh took to Twitter and shared the figures. He wrote:

#GullyBoy is Ranveer Singh’s second biggest opener... Lower than #Simmba... Higher than #Padmaavat... Opening Day:

1. #Simmba ₹ 20.72 cr

2. #GullyBoy ₹ 19.40 cr [Thu; revised]

3. #Padmaavat ₹ 19 cr [Thu]

4. #Gunday ₹ 16.12 cr

5. #GoliyonKiRaasleelaRamLeela ₹ 16 cr

India biz.

The film presents the two stars in a never-seen-before avatar. The venture is co-produced by Zoya Akhtar's Tiger Baby and Excel Entertainment productions. Ranveer Singh, Alia Bhatt, Kalki Koechlin, Siddhant Chaturvedi and Vijay Raaz in pivotal parts.

The movie will again gain big from the extended weekend, as it released on a Thursday. Also, there is a strong positive word of mouth publicity doing the rounds on social media which will push the crowd to throng the theatres in huge numbers.
